process for inside booklet, i will have to make a few changes, i mixed up the tenses, and apparently the -Girl you are a camel- cannot be said. Like in arabic, everything must agree with gender so technically you cannot say girl you are a camel because camel in arabic has two different words for a female camel. If I would want to keep the same idea, i i will have to creatively decide what essentials parts I want to keep-aspect of girl-aspect of camel? ?

some English words derived from Arabic
admiral - ami:r-al-bahr 'ruler of the seas' (and other similar expressions) - amara command adobe - al-toba 'the brick' alchemy - al-ki:mi:a: - from Greek alcohol - al-koh''l 'the kohl' alcove - al-qobbah 'vault' - qubba vault alfalfa - alfas,fas,ah 'fodder' algebra - al-jebr 'reintegration' - jabara reunite algorithm - al-Khowarazmi 'the (man) of Khiva' Allah - `allah, from contraction of al-ilah 'the god' almanac - (Andalucian Arabic) al-mana:kh, of uncertain origin amber - `anbar 'ambergris' antimony - al-íthmid 'antimony trisulphide' - perhaps from Greek apricot - al-burquq - from Greek arsenal - dar as,s,ina`ah 'house of making', i.e. 'factory' - s,ana`a make artichoke - al-kharshu:f assassin - h'ashsha:shi:n 'hashish eaters', from the Isma`ili sectarians
barbican - (possibly) bâb-al-baqara 'gate with holes' bled - balad 'vast open country' borax - bu:raq - from Persian burka - burqa` caliber - qali:b 'mold, last' - caliph - khali:fah 'successor' - khalafa 'succeed' camise - qami:s 'shirt' - from Latin candy - short for 'sugar candy', from sugar + qandi 'candied', from qand 'cane sugar' - from a Dravidian language carat - qi:ra:t 'small weight' - from Greek caraway - alkarawya: - probably from Greek carmine - qirmazi: 'crimson' carob - kharrubah cassock - kaza:ghand 'padded jacket' - from Persian check - sha:h 'king' - from Persian chemistry - see alchemy chess - from Old French eschecs, plural of check coffee - qahwah cork - qu:rq cotton - qutn couscous - kuskus - kaskasa pound, bruise crimson - qirmazi:, related to the qirmiz, the insect that provided the dye
